Women’s Chorus plans weekend concerts

Music lovers can hear America singing — and America, in this case, includes them — as the Orange County Women’s Chorus mounts a pair of shows this weekend.

Saturday at St. Wilfrid of York Episcopal Church, 18631 Chapel Lane, Huntington Beach, baritone Carver Cossey will join the choir for “I Hear America Singing,” a program that spans the years from post-Revolutionary War tunes to folk, George Gershwin and gospel. The show begins at 7 p.m.

Sunday at 3 p.m., the program will repeat at Newport Harbor Lutheran Church, 798 Dover Drive, Newport Beach. Admission to both shows is $25 for adults, $20 for seniors (65 and older) and $10 for students with identification.

At both shows, audience members will be invited to sing along, and an ice cream social with the performers will follow.
